近似查找,在表格处理软件中,通常指的是当用户无法提供完全精确的匹配条件时,系统能够基于一定的容错规则或相似度算法,从数据集中找出最接近或最相关的信息。这一功能在处理含有拼写差异、格式不一致或存在部分数据缺失的表格时尤为关键。它并非要求字面完全一致,而是追求逻辑上的关联与内容上的贴合,从而有效提升数据检索的灵活性与实用性。
核心价值与应用场景 该功能的核心价值在于应对现实数据中的不完美性。在日常工作中,数据来源多样,录入过程难免出现偏差,例如客户名称的简写、产品型号的细微差别或日期格式的不统一。近似查找能力使得用户无需花费大量时间手动清洗和标准化数据,即可快速定位目标,极大地节省了时间成本。其典型应用场景包括:在庞大的客户名单中匹配相似名称,在库存清单里查找型号相近的产品,或在财务记录中核对存在录入误差的金额项目。 实现原理与常见方法 从技术角度看,近似查找的实现依赖于特定的匹配算法。最常见的实现方式是通过模糊匹配函数,这类函数允许用户设定一个相似度阈值,系统会计算查询值与列表中每个值的相似程度,并返回超过阈值的最优结果。另一种常见思路是使用通配符,用特定符号代表不确定的字符,进行模式匹配。此外,部分高级功能还能基于发音相似性或文本包含关系进行查找。这些方法共同构成了近似查找的技术基础,让数据处理变得更加智能和人性化。 操作要点与注意事项 要有效运用近似查找,用户需掌握几个要点。首先,需要明确查找目标与数据现状,选择合适的匹配方法。其次,理解不同函数的参数含义至关重要,例如阈值设置过高可能找不到结果,过低则可能返回大量不相关项。同时,需注意近似查找可能带来多结果或歧义,因此对返回结果进行人工复核是保证数据准确性的必要步骤。合理利用这一功能,能化繁为简,成为处理复杂数据的有力工具。在数据管理的日常实践中,我们常常会遇到这样的困境:手头的信息与表格中的记录并非严丝合缝,可能存在着这样那样的出入。这时,精确查找便显得力不从心,而近似查找则成为破局的关键。它像是一位经验丰富的助手,能够理解你的意图,即便指令有些模糊,也能从纷杂的数据中为你指出最可能的答案。下面,我们将从不同维度深入剖析这一功能。
功能理念与核心逻辑 近似查找功能的诞生,源于对现实世界数据不完美性的深刻洞察。其核心逻辑是“求同存异”,即在无法做到百分百一致的情况下,寻找最大公约数。它通过一系列预设的规则和算法,评估查询条件与目标数据之间的相似程度,而非简单地判断“是”或“否”。这种思维方式将查找行为从机械的字符比对,提升到了语义关联的层面。例如,当查找“北京分公司”时,即使数据表中记录的是“北京分司”或“北京公司”,系统也能识别出它们的高度关联性并予以返回。这种灵活性,正是其区别于传统精确查找的根本所在。 实现途径的分类解析 近似查找的实现并非只有单一道路,而是有多种技术路径可供选择,每种方法都有其适用的场景和特点。 基于模糊匹配函数的查找 这是最为强大和系统化的实现方式。这类函数通常内置了文本相似度计算引擎。用户在使用时,除了提供查找值,往往还可以指定一个称为“相似度阈值”的参数。系统会默默计算查找值与数据列表中每一个候选值的相似度得分,这个得分可能基于编辑距离(将一个字符串转换成另一个所需的最少单字符编辑次数)、共同子串长度或其他复杂算法得出。最后,系统会筛选出得分超过阈值的结果,并通常将得分最高者作为最佳匹配返回。这种方法智能化程度高,尤其擅长处理拼写错误、多余空格或顺序颠倒等问题。 基于通配符的模式匹配 这是一种更为直观和由用户主动控制的近似查找方式。它允许在查找条件中使用特殊符号来代表未知或可变的字符。最常见的通配符包括问号,它代表任意单个字符;以及星号,它代表任意数量的任意字符序列。例如,使用“张?伟”可以找到“张三伟”、“张四伟”等;使用“北京公司”则可以匹配所有以“北京”开头、以“公司”结尾的字符串。这种方法赋予用户极大的灵活性,特别适用于已知部分固定模式、但部分内容不确定的查找场景,操作门槛相对较低。 基于文本包含关系的查找 这种方法不追求整体匹配,而是关注查找值是否为目标字符串的一部分。通过特定的查找函数,用户可以快速筛选出所有包含某个关键词或词组的记录。例如,在一个产品描述列表中,查找所有包含“环保”二字的产品。这在实际工作中应用极广,比如从大量新闻标题中筛选某一主题,或从客户反馈中提取提及特定问题的记录。它本质上是一种语义上的近似,侧重于内容的关联性而非形式的统一。 关键技巧与实践指南 要娴熟运用近似查找,将其价值最大化,需要掌握一些关键技巧并注意相关事项。 前期准备与数据观察 在动手查找之前,花几分钟观察数据特征是非常有益的。查看目标列中数据的常见变异形式:是首尾有多余空格,是大小写不一致,还是存在常见的同音别字?了解这些模式,有助于你选择最对症的查找方法。如果数据混乱程度很高,有时先进行简单的清洗(如去除空格、统一大小写)能大幅提升后续近似查找的准确率和效率。 方法选择与参数调优 没有一种方法能解决所有问题。应根据具体情况灵活选择:对于已知部分结构的查找,通配符法直接高效;对于从大段文本中提取信息,包含关系查找是首选;而对于处理复杂的拼写变异和相似词,模糊匹配函数则能力最强。当使用模糊函数时,“阈值”参数的设定是个技术活。建议先从较高的阈值开始尝试,如果返回结果过少或没有,再逐步调低阈值以放宽限制,直到取得满意的结果平衡点。 结果验证与误差控制 必须清醒认识到,近似查找的本质决定了其结果可能包含不确定性。系统认为的“最相似”结果,未必就是用户心中想要的“正确”结果。因此,对返回的结果进行人工复核是必不可少的步骤,尤其当数据用于关键决策或财务报告时。可以设计简单的交叉验证,比如用找到的关键信息去关联查询其他相关字段,看逻辑是否自洽。对于非常重要的批量匹配操作,可以考虑先用一小部分样本数据测试查找效果,确认无误后再推广到全量数据。 高级应用与组合策略 近似查找不仅可以单独使用,更能与其他功能组合,形成更强大的数据处理方案。例如,可以将近似查找函数嵌套在条件判断函数中,实现更复杂的业务逻辑判断;也可以将其与数据透视功能结合,对模糊匹配后的结果进行快速汇总分析。在数据整合场景中,近似查找常作为关键步骤,用于匹配来自不同系统的、标准不一的表,从而完成数据的关联与融合。掌握这些组合技巧,能让你在面对复杂数据挑战时更加游刃有余。 总而言之,近似查找绝非一个简单的功能选项,它体现的是一种适应现实、灵活变通的数据处理哲学。从理解其原理,到选择合适方法,再到审慎验证结果,每一步都需要用心思考和练习。当你真正掌握它时,便会发现,那些曾经令人头疼的不规则数据,将不再成为工作中的拦路虎,反而可能成为挖掘深层信息的钥匙。
137人看过